China's PMI up to 50.3 percent in March


(MENAFN) China's manufacturing sector saw a slight rise in purchasing managers' index (PMI) in March to 50.3 percent compared to 50.2 percent in February, according to Qatar News Agency



PMI registered its first month-on-month rise in March since November.



Zhao Qinghe, a senior analyst with the NBS, said that a reading below 50 indicates contraction, while above 50 signals expansion
